A military spouse is taking care of a newborn and her incarcerated sister's 3-year-old daughter alone while her husband is deployed overseas. Her husband volunteered her to drive his colleague's pregnant and mentally ill wife to her early morning appointments without asking her first.

The exhausted spouse refused, explaining that she is already physically and emotionally drained and cannot take on additional responsibilities without risking her own mental health. However, her husband became upset, arguing that she should help others in need and that she is being insensitive.
